节段设计原则在小切口入路坚固内固定治疗颌面部骨折的应用

中文摘要:目的 探讨节段设计原则在小切口入路坚固内固定治疗颌面部骨折的应用效果。方法 采用回顾性研究方法,选择2012年9月~2016年4月在笔者医院诊治的颌面部骨折患者172例作为研究对象,根据治疗方法的不同分为观察组100例与对照组72例,两组都给予小切口入路坚固内固定治疗,观察组在术前设计中遵循节段设计原则,其他手术过程同对照组。结果 所有患者均完成手术,骨折均为Ⅰ期愈合;术后3个月,在总有效率上,观察组达到98.0%,对照组达到83.3%,观察组明显高于对照组(P<0.05)。观察组术后3个月的感染、面神经损伤、涎瘘、螺钉松动等并发症发生率为3.0%,对照组为20.8%,观察组明显低于对照组(P<0.05)。观察组咬合关系与张口正常率分别为99.0%和98.0%,对照组为93.1%和90.3%,两两比较差异均有统计学意义(P<0.05)。结论 节段设计原则在小切口入路坚固内固定治疗颌面部骨折的应用具有很高的成功率,能提高治疗效果,减少术后并发症的发生,提高咬合关系与张口正常率,是治疗颌面部骨折较理想的方法。

Application of Segmental Design Principles in the Small Incision Approach Rigid Internal Fixation for the Treatment of Maxillofacial Fractures
Abstract:Objective To explore the application effects of segmental design principles in the small incision approach rigid internal fixation for the treatment of maxillofacial fractures. Methods With a retrospective study, from September 2012 to April 2016, 172 patients with maxillofacial fractures were selected as the research object in our hospital. All the patients were divided into the observation group of 100 patients and control group of patients according to the different treatment methods. Two groups were treated with mall incision approach rigid internal fixation. The observation group were given the preoperative design based on the segmental design principles. The other operation process were similar with the control group. Results All patients were completed the operation, the fracture were healed by Ⅰ stage. The postoperative 3months of total effective rates of the observation group and the control group were 98.0% and 83.3%. The total effective rate of the observation group was significantly higher than that of the control group (P<0.05). The postoperative 3months of infection, nerve injury, salivary fistula, screw loosening and complication rate in the observation group was 3.0%, so that was 20.8% in the control group, the observation group was significantly lower than the control group (P<0.05). The postoperative 3months of occlusal relationship and normal rates of the observation group were 99.0% and 98.0%, respectively. The control group was 93.1% and 90.3%, respectively. There were between the two groups statistically significance difference(P<0.05). Conclusion The segmental design principles in the small incision approach rigid internal fixation for the treatment of maxillofacial fractures can improve the therapeutic effect, reduce the incidence of postoperative complications, improve the occlusal relationship with normal mouth opening rate. It is an ideal method for the treatment of maxillofacial fracture.
